[On presidential candidates not condemning the controversial MoveOn. org ad in The New York Times.] If you're not tough enough to repudiate a scurrilous, outrageous attack such as that, then I don't know how you're tough enough to be president of the United States.
As quoted in The Boston Globe (16 September 2007).
